What “Situs Game Online” Means Today
At its core, the term covers two major categories:

  1. Legitimate online gaming platforms — providers of multiplayer games, e-sports, social gaming, and in-game transactions (skins, virtual items). These are often driven by large developers and operate under standard commercial terms.
  2. Real-money gambling sites — online casinos, sportsbook operators, and peer-to-peer wagering platforms where users stake real currency. These services frequently brand themselves as “situs” to target regional audiences.

Although the technology behind both types overlaps (web apps, mobile apps, live streaming, payment gateways), the regulatory treatment and societal impacts differ sharply.

Risks and Harms — My Concerned Perspective
From a policy and consumer-protection standpoint, several risks stand out.

  • Legal uncertainty: Many situs game online operators target markets where regulation is unclear or enforcement is weak. Users may inadvertently engage with unlicensed or illegal services.
  • Financial risk and fraud: Unregulated platforms increase the risk of payment fraud, unfair play mechanics, and difficulties withdrawing funds.
  • Addiction and social harm: The ease of access and gamified monetization (microtransactions, variable rewards) can lead to problematic gambling and gaming behavior, especially among young people.
  • Data privacy and security: Weak protections can expose users to data breaches and identity theft.
  • Match-fixing and unfair competition: In wagering and e-sports, integrity issues emerge when oversight is absent.

Given these factors, a cautious approach is not merely prudent — it is essential.

Regulatory Landscape (General Observations)
Regulatory regimes vary by country. Some jurisdictions ban most forms of online gambling, others permit regulated operators under strict licensing, and some operate in a gray zone. Effective regulation typically requires:

  • Clear licensing regimes for operators.
  • Consumer protections (age checks, deposit limits, dispute resolution).
  • Financial transparency and anti-money-laundering safeguards.
  • Advertising restrictions and disclosure requirements.

Where regulation is lacking, the market tends to concentrate in offshore or anonymized platforms — which amplifies risks.

Practical, Responsible Guidelines for Users
If you choose to engage with situs game online, follow these principles to protect yourself:

  1. Verify licensing and regulation. Prefer operators licensed by reputable authorities and able to show public certifications.
  2. Confirm transparent payment methods. Use well-known payment processors and avoid platforms insisting on obscure crypto-only withdrawals unless you understand the risks.
  3. Read terms and withdrawal policies carefully. Withdrawal restrictions are a common source of disputes.
  4. Use strict bankroll management. Treat any wagering as entertainment expenditure — set firm limits and never chase losses.
  5. Protect privacy and accounts. Use unique passwords, two-factor authentication, and be cautious about sharing personal data.
  6. Watch for predatory mechanics. Avoid platforms that heavily push loot boxes, aggressive microtransactions, or opaque odds.
  7. Seek help early. If you notice compulsive behavior, use self-exclusion tools and consult local support services for gambling addiction.
